Review Of Medigap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ans to choose from. These insurance plans are controlled by the US authorities Medicare and are designed to work with Initial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ans are standardized and controlled, the benefits are the same no matter what company is offering the plan. The only difference between the exact same plan letter with different companies is the price. Medigap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the more popular supplement insurance plans. This pl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. For instance, F insures anything that happens in a doctor ‘s office or some other medical facility at 100%, all hospital bills, and the Part A deductible. This really is the only Medicare Supplement Plan that offers 100% full coverage that is all-inclusive.
Medigap Insurance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a insurance plan we like to urge the most and often referred to as the Gold Plan. It really is almost identical to Plan F. The only difference is a yearly de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the benefits are just the same as Plan F. The reason we enjoy Plan G is because the premiums are substantially less than Plan F.
Medicare Supplement Plan N
Medigap Plan N comes with a $50 copay at the ER, an office copay of 0 to $20, Part B deductible of $166 unless you’re acknowledged, and Part B excess costs aren’t covered.. .. This plan is beneficial to individuals who would like to love a lower premium have almost complete coverage at the hospital and other high medical bills that can happen.

When Is The Best Time To Buy A Medicare Supplement Plan?
When you’re first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ment the best time to buy Medicare Supplement Plan is. During this time which begins six months before your 65th birthday and last for six months after your 65th birthday you can sign up regardless of your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There aren’t any questions for pre-existing conditions and you can get any Medigap plan you desire from any carrier
If you’re looking to change insurance plans or get a plan for the very first time and past the age of 65 you may have to answer some fundamental health questions to qualify. Most folks and qualify so you should still be able to get a plan.
